England fans blamed Jonny Wilkinson for Harry Kane’s penalty miss during World Cup 

England fans have pointed the finger at rugby legend Johnny Wilkinson for Harry Kane’s penalty miss against France in 2022, following the resurfacing of an old comedy sketch.

The video, which recently gained traction on social media, shows Wilkinson advising Kane on penalty-taking, with an unexpected twist.

The unfortunate miss occurred as Kane sent the ball soaring over the crossbar, a rare blunder for the England captain known for his 84% penalty success rate.

Kane, who has a stellar record spanning a 13-year professional career, found himself outwitted by his Tottenham Hotspur teammate, French goalkeeper Hugo Lloris.

The comedy sketch, filmed for Sport Relief in 2018, features Wilkinson alongside comedian John Bishop. In the video, Wilkinson humorously instructs Kane to aim high and over the goal, referencing his own winning kick at the 2003 Rugby World Cup.

“That’s how you do it,” Wilkinson declares with satisfaction, leaving Kane puzzled as he responds, “You just put it over by a mile.” Wilkinson, undeterred, replies, “Yes, but that’s how I won a World Cup with England.”
